CA Osasuna enters as the slight favorite at home against Getafe CF due to the advantage of playing at Estadio El Sadar and a solid home record in La Liga fixtures. Getafe's organized defensive setup and tendency toward low-scoring encounters support the notable draw probability, while their away form limits higher confidence in an away win. Recent team news highlights limited absences, with Osasuna without Raúl Moro and Getafe missing Juanmi plus long-term casualty Chrisantus Uche. Both sides begin the 2026-27 campaign with comparable mid-table expectations following Getafe's prior European qualification push and Osasuna's survival battle, keeping the matchup competitively balanced with room for home momentum or a stalemate to shape outcomes.
